does the Garmin edge 500 use same cadence sensor as 305?
My 305 is crapping out on me so I'm looking at the 500. It looks like it uses the same speed/cadence sensor as the 305 which would save me $100 on the bundle. Can anyone confirm this for me before I spend the cash? Thanks.

305 and 500 use the GSC10, which has a SRP of $60 and can be found around for less than $40.
